Transaction 98f61490571fc593b19917d4e4fd44469b3aae9579b9637e4d667b4b08ce01ca

block
364f34480ddaaa12cc59500c3a6867faaa0ea99e5b4a1fcc80603936abd352db

1 Input

23 Outputs